Kwara Governor Approves Temporary PAYE-Matching Bonus for Civil Servants
Kwara State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has approved a special financial bonus matching the monthly Pay-As-You-Earn (PAYE) tax amount for all civil servants in the state, including those employed at the local government level.
According to a statement from the Commissioner for Finance, Dr Hauwa Nuru, this financial relief initiative is set to be in effect for at least three months, providing temporary economic support to public sector employees across Kwara.
“This bonus has been approved as a buffer to bridge the gap that the correct PAYE deduction may have wrought on the newly implemented mininum wage. It is meant to serve as a soothing balm as workers adjust to the PAYE that was just correctly implemented in line with the Personal Income Tax Act,” she said.
“The payment of the bonus is effective from October and will run till December 2024. This is a significant step by His Excellency to support workers.”
The statement added that workers who have not registered with the Kwara State Residents' Registration Agency (KWSRRA) should do so immediately because anyone without it will not get the bonus for November and December.
The statement said labour unions have also agreed to a refund of the special levy deducted from workers' salary and suspension of deductions of same until further notice.
“Governor AbdulRazaq's directive to deliver this relief speaks volumes about his humanity and his commitment to the welfare of Kwara workforce,” Dr. Nuru stated.
